The Do’s And Don’ts When Water Floods Your Home
Water offers life, however water invasion on some components where it's not expected to be can result in damage and also inconvenience. In addition, houses with water damages smell mildewy and also old.

Water can originate from many resources like tropical cyclones, floodings, ruptured pipelines, leakages, and also sewage system problems. It's better to have a functioning understanding of safety and security preventative measures if you have water damage. Here are a couple of guidelines on just how to deal with water damages.

Do Prioritize Home Insurance Coverage



Seasonal water damages can come from floodings, seasonal rainfalls, as well as wind. There is likewise an event of an abrupt flood, whether it came from a defective pipe that all of a sudden breaks right into your house. To safeguard your home, get house insurance policy that covers both acts of God such as natural catastrophes, and emergencies like damaged plumbing.

Do Not Fail To Remember to Switch Off Energies



When disaster strikes and you're in a flood-prone area, switch off the primary electric circuit. Turning off the power prevents
When water comes in as water offers as a conductor, electric shocks. Don't fail to remember to turn off the primary water line shutoff as a method to stop more damages.
Maintain your furniture steady as they can relocate around and also cause extra damages if the floodwaters are obtaining high.

Do Remain Proactive and also Heed Climate Signals



If you live in an area afflicted by floods, stay prepared and proactive at all times. Listen to the information and evacuation cautions if you live near a body of water like a creek, lake, or river .

Don't Overlook the Roof



Before the climate transforms frightful as well as for the even worse, do a roofing assessment. A better practice is to have a yearly roof covering inspection to minimize complex issues as well as future problems. A great roofing without any leakages as well as openings can be a good shield versus a device and the rain to avoid rainfall damage. Your roofing contractor should deal with the defective gutters or any other indicators of damage or weakening. An inspection will certainly protect against water from flowing down your wall surfaces and soaking your ceiling.

Do Pay Attention to Small Leakages



There are red flags that can attract your interest and also show to you some weakened pipelines in your home. Signs of red flags in your pipes include gurgling paint, peeling wallpaper, water streaks, water discolorations, or leaking audios behind the wall surfaces. Repair service and also evaluate your plumbing fixed before it results in massive damage to your house, financial resources, as well as an individual headache.

Don't Panic in Case of a Burst Pipeline



Keeping your presence of mind is crucial in a time of crisis. Due to the fact that it will stifle you from acting fast, stressing will just worsen the trouble. Panic will certainly likewise offer you added stress. Timing is crucial when it involves water damage. The longer you wait, the more damages you can anticipate as well as the most awful the results can be. If a pipe bursts in your home, right away shut down your primary water valve to remove the source and also protect against even more damage. Unplug all electric outlets in the area or shut off the circuit breaker for that part of your house. Lastly, call a trusted water damage repair expert for aid.

The Dos and Don’ts if you Face a Water Damage


What to do immediately




  • Immediately turn off the source of water to stop further damage


  • The breaker should also be turned off in the damaged area


  • Switch of any electrical devices that may be in the affected area


  • Lift up draperies and put a pin on the furniture skirts to prevent them from getting wet


  • Remove things from the carpet that may leave stains such as newspaper, books, plants, baskets etc.


  • If you have home insurance, call up the company to send someone to assess the damage


  • If you are removing stuff before their arrival, click photographs so that they can assess the damage


  • Call up a reliable water damage restoration company. They are proficient in handling such situations which helps minimize damage


  • Move any valuable stuff such as paintings, art work, photographs etc from the damaged area.


  • Remove any small furniture from the wet area and move to dry, safe regions


  • Wipe furniture and open drawers to enable quick drying

  • What you should not do




  • Never try to use home vacuum cleaners to dry wet areas. You may get an electric shock


  • Do not walk on the wet area more than necessary as it may cause water to spread in the dry areas


  • Never try to dry wet areas using newspapers. Its ink spreads fast and may aggravate damage


  • Never switch on TV or other electrical appliances on the wet carpet or floor


  • Do not use HVAC system if it has been affected by water


  • Do not disturb visible mold. It is best treated by professionals
